Output e2cfc906aefa1cf9a1694fb098dfa955007532a2ac77f475b9c15ba783245dea:1

value
65920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898a57b33584f9f86d14ae90020107d474878d56 OP_EQUAL
address
3EEGE31FEnT7w6aRjKXXyxmYfQ35GaXmtf
transaction
e2cfc906aefa1cf9a1694fb098dfa955007532a2ac77f475b9c15ba783245dea
confirmations
441672
spent
true